แปลง XPS เป็น TEX โดยใช้ .NET GroupDocs.Conversion: คำแนะนำทีละขั้นตอน

การแนะนำ

ในยุคดิจิทัล การแปลงไฟล์ที่หลากหลายถือเป็นสิ่งสำคัญ ไม่ว่าคุณจะเป็นนักวิจัยด้านวิชาการที่ต้องการแปลงเอกสารหรือเป็นนักพัฒนาซอฟต์แวร์ที่ทำงานเกี่ยวกับโซลูชันการจัดการเอกสาร การแปลงไฟล์อย่างมีประสิทธิภาพและแม่นยำถือเป็นสิ่งสำคัญ คู่มือนี้จะแนะนำคุณเกี่ยวกับการใช้ GroupDocs.Conversion สำหรับ .NET เพื่อแปลงไฟล์ XPS เป็นรูปแบบ TEX ซึ่งเป็นงานที่ทำให้การแชร์เอกสารทางวิทยาศาสตร์ที่จัดรูปแบบใน LaTeX ง่ายขึ้น

สิ่งที่คุณจะได้เรียนรู้:

  • วิธีโหลดไฟล์ XPS โดยใช้ GroupDocs.Conversion
  • แปลงไฟล์ XPS เป็น TEX ได้อย่างง่ายดาย
  • ตั้งค่าสภาพแวดล้อมของคุณและจัดการการอ้างอิงอย่างมีประสิทธิภาพ

ตอนนี้เรามาดูข้อกำหนดเบื้องต้นที่จำเป็นสำหรับบทช่วยสอนนี้กัน

ข้อกำหนดเบื้องต้น

ก่อนที่เราจะเริ่มนำเครื่องมือการแปลงของเราไปใช้งาน ให้แน่ใจว่าคุณมีสิ่งต่อไปนี้:

ไลบรารี เวอร์ชัน และการอ้างอิงที่จำเป็น:

  • GroupDocs.การแปลงสำหรับ .NET: เวอร์ชัน 25.3.0
  • ความรู้พื้นฐานเกี่ยวกับการเขียนโปรแกรม C#
  • IDE เช่น Visual Studio สำหรับการพัฒนา

ข้อกำหนดการตั้งค่าสภาพแวดล้อม:

  • สภาพแวดล้อมการทำงานของ .NET (ควรเป็น .NET Core หรือ Framework)

การตั้งค่า GroupDocs.Conversion สำหรับ .NET

ในการเริ่มต้น คุณต้องติดตั้งไลบรารี GroupDocs.Conversion ในโครงการของคุณ ดังต่อไปนี้:

คอนโซลตัวจัดการแพ็กเกจ N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

ขั้นตอนการรับใบอนุญาต

การเริ่มต้นและการตั้งค่าเบื้องต้น

นี่คือวิธีเริ่มต้น GroupDocs.Conversion ในโครงการ C# ของคุณ:

using System.IO;
using GroupDocs.Conversion;

string sourceFilePath = "YOUR_DOCUMENT_DIRECTORY\\sample.xps";
// เริ่มต้นตัวแปลงด้วยไฟล์ XPS ที่โหลดแล้ว
using (var converter = new Converter(sourceFilePath))
{
    // ตรรกะการแปลงจะถูกเพิ่มที่นี่ภายหลัง
}

คู่มือการใช้งาน

โหลดคุณสมบัติไฟล์ XPS

ฟีเจอร์นี้มีความจำเป็นสำหรับการเริ่มกระบวนการแปลงใดๆ มาดูรายละเอียดกัน:

ขั้นตอนที่ 1: เริ่มต้นวัตถุตัวแปลง

การ Converter คลาสนี้มีความสำคัญอย่างยิ่งในการจัดการไฟล์ของคุณ การส่งเส้นทางไปยังไฟล์ XPS จะช่วยให้คุณสร้างพื้นฐานสำหรับการแปลงไฟล์ครั้งต่อไปได้

string sourceFilePath = "YOUR_DOCUMENT_DIRECTORY\\sample.xps";
using (var converter = new Converter(sourceFilePath))
{
    // ตรรกะการแปลงจะถูกเพิ่มที่นี่ภายหลัง
}
  • เหตุใดจึงก้าวขั้นนี้? การเริ่มต้นด้วยเส้นทางที่ถูกต้องจะทำให้แน่ใจว่า GroupDocs.Conversion สามารถเข้าถึงเอกสารของคุณเพื่อประมวลผลได้

แปลง XPS เป็นรูปแบบ TEX

เมื่อคุณโหลดไฟล์ XPS เสร็จแล้ว ก็ถึงเวลาแปลงไฟล์เป็นรูปแบบ TEX ซึ่งคุณสามารถใช้ตัวเลือกการแปลงที่ออกแบบมาเฉพาะสำหรับรูปแบบเป้าหมายของคุณ

ขั้นตอนที่ 2: กำหนดค่าตัวเลือกการแปลง

การตั้งค่าตัวเลือกการแปลงที่ถูกต้องจะรับประกันว่าผลลัพธ์ของคุณตรงตามความคาดหวัง ดังต่อไปนี้:

string outputFolder =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putFolder, "xps-converted-to.tex");
P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ions { Format = PageDescriptionLanguageFileType.Tex };
// แปลงเอกสาร XPS ที่โหลดเป็นรูปแบบ TEX
converter.Convert(outputFile, options);
  • เหตุใดจึงก้าวขั้นนี้? การระบุ PageDescriptionLanguageConvertOptions ช่วยให้แน่ใจว่าการแปลงของคุณตรงตามข้อกำหนดของไฟล์ TEX

เคล็ดลับการแก้ไขปัญหา

  • ตรวจสอบให้แน่ใจว่าเส้นทางทั้งหมดถูกต้องและสามารถเข้าถึงได้
  • ตรวจสอบว่าคุณมีสิทธิ์ที่จำเป็นในการอ่าน/เขียนไฟล์ในไดเร็กทอรีที่ระบุ
  • ตรวจสอบดูว่ามีเวอร์ชันใดที่ไม่ตรงกันใน GroupDocs.Conversion

การประยุกต์ใช้งานจริง

GroupDocs.Conversion สามารถรวมเข้ากับสถานการณ์จริงต่างๆ ได้:

  1. การตีพิมพ์ผลงานทางวิชาการ:แปลงเอกสารการวิจัยจาก XPS เป็น TEX เพื่อการแก้ไขและส่งที่ง่ายดาย
  2. ระบบจัดเก็บเอกสาร:เปิดใช้งานการเปลี่ยนรูปแบบอย่างราบรื่นภายในไลบรารีดิจิทัล
  3. แพลตฟอร์มการทำงานร่วมกัน: อำนวยความสะดวกในการแบ่งปันเอกสารในรูปแบบที่แตกต่างกัน

การพิจารณาประสิทธิภาพ

เมื่อทำงานกับการแปลงไฟล์ การเพิ่มประสิทธิภาพเป็นสิ่งสำคัญ:

  • แนวทางการใช้ทรัพยากร:ตรวจสอบการใช้หน่วยความจำเพื่อป้องกันปัญหาคอขวดระหว่างการแปลงชุดข้อมูลจำนวนมาก
  • แนวทางปฏิบัติที่ดีที่สุดสำหรับการจัดการหน่วยความจำ .NET: กำจัดสิ่งของอย่างถูกวิธีและใช้งาน using คำชี้แจงเพื่อบริหารจัดการทรัพยากรอย่างมีประสิทธิภาพ

บทสรุป

ตอนนี้คุณน่าจะมีความเข้าใจที่ชัดเจนเกี่ยวกับวิธีการนำการแปลง XPS ไปเป็น TEX โดยใช้ GroupDocs.Conversion ใน C# มาใช้ คู่มือนี้ครอบคลุมถึงกระบวนการติดตั้ง ขั้นตอนการใช้งานโดยละเอียด และการใช้งานจริง หากต้องการศึกษาความสามารถของ GroupDocs.Conversion เพิ่มเติม โปรดพิจารณาเจาะลึกคุณลักษณะและการผสานรวมขั้นสูงเพิ่มเติม

ขั้นตอนต่อไป:ทดลองแปลงรูปแบบไฟล์อื่นหรือรวมฟังก์ชันนี้เข้ากับโปรเจ็กต์ขนาดใหญ่

ส่วนคำถามที่พบบ่อย

  1. GroupDocs.Conversion สำหรับ .NET คืออะไร
    • เป็นไลบรารีอันทรงพลังในการแปลงข้อมูลระหว่างรูปแบบเอกสารต่างๆ ในแอปพลิเคชัน .NET
  2. ฉันสามารถใช้ GroupDocs.Conversion แบบออฟไลน์ได้หรือไม่
    • ใช่ เมื่อติดตั้งผ่าน NuGet หรือวิธีการอื่นแล้ว สามารถใช้งานโดยไม่ต้องเชื่อมต่ออินเทอร์เน็ตได้
  3. รูปแบบไฟล์ใดบ้างที่ GroupDocs.Conversion รองรับในการแปลง?
    • รองรับรูปแบบเอกสารมากกว่า 50 รูปแบบ รวมถึง PDF, DOCX, XPS และ TEX
  4. มี GroupDocs.Conversion เวอร์ชันฟรีให้ใช้งานหรือไม่
    • มีเวอร์ชันทดลองใช้เพื่อทดสอบคุณสมบัติต่างๆ ก่อนซื้อใบอนุญาตเต็มรูปแบบ
  5. ฉันจะจัดการข้อผิดพลาดระหว่างการแปลงอย่างไร
    • นำบล็อก try-catch ไปใช้งานรอบตรรกะการแปลงของคุณเพื่อจัดการข้อยกเว้นอย่างเหมาะสม

ทรัพยากร

ร่วมออกเดินทางกับ GroupDocs.Conversion วันนี้ และปลดล็อกศักยภาพของการแปลงเอกสารอย่างราบรื่นใน .NET!